Home | History | Annotate | Download | only in token-rewrite

Lines Matching defs:rewrite

18   def rewrite( input, expected )
27 rewrite( 'abc', '0abc' ) do |stream|
33 rewrite( 'abc', 'abcx' ) do |stream|
39 rewrite( 'abc', 'axbxc' ) do |stream|
46 rewrite( 'abc', 'xbc' ) do |stream|
52 rewrite( 'abc', 'abx' ) do |stream|
58 rewrite( 'abc', 'abx' ) do |stream|
64 rewrite( 'abc', 'axc' ) do |stream|
70 rewrite( 'abc', 'ayc' ) do |stream|
77 rewrite( 'abc', '_ayc' ) do |stream|
85 rewrite( 'abc', 'ac' ) do |stream|
92 rewrite 'abc', 'xbc' do |stream|
99 rewrite( "abc", "ayxbc" ) do |stream|
106 rewrite( "abc", "zbc" ) do |stream|
114 rewrite( "abc", "abyx" ) do |stream|
121 rewrite( "abc", "abx" ) do |stream|
128 rewrite( "abc", "abxy" ) do |stream|
135 rewrite( "abcccba", "abyxba" ) do |stream|
142 rewrite( "abcccba", "abxyba" ) do |stream|
149 rewrite( "abcccba", "x" ) do |stream|
155 rewrite( "abcba", "fooa" ) do |stream|
162 rewrite( "abc", "yxabc" ) do |stream|
169 rewrite( "abc", "yazxbc" ) do |stream|
177 rewrite( "abc", "zaxbyc" ) do |stream|
185 rewrite( "abcc", "axbfoo" ) do |stream|
192 rewrite( "abcc", "axbfoo" ) do |stream|
199 rewrite( "abc", "z" ) do |stream|
206 rewrite( "abcc", "bar" ) do |stream|
213 rewrite( "abcc", "barc" ) do |stream|
220 rewrite( "abcc", "abar" ) do |stream|
289 def rewrite( input )
295 stream = rewrite 'x = 3 * 0;'
304 stream = rewrite 'x = 3 * 0 + 2 * 0;'